The Axe Body Spray Debate

The question “do women like Axe body spray?” has sparked conversations for years. Axe has built a reputation as a fragrance marketed to young men, often promising confidence and attraction in a single spray. For many, it was their first introduction to using a body spray in their teenage years. But does this bold promise truly align with how women feel about the scent? While some find it nostalgic and appealing, others describe it as overpowering or too synthetic. Understanding why opinions are divided can help uncover whether Axe still holds its place in modern fragrance culture.

Marketing vs Reality

Axe gained popularity in the early 2000s with commercials suggesting that women were instantly drawn to men wearing their spray. The brand successfully captured attention with humorous, exaggerated campaigns. However, in reality, women’s opinions are more nuanced. Some enjoy the fresh and youthful vibe of certain scents, while others feel the fragrance is too strong when applied excessively. This gap between advertising and real-life reactions has fueled the ongoing debate. It highlights the importance of moderation and context when wearing any fragrance, not just Axe.

Real Women Share Their Opinions

Across online forums and casual conversations, women express mixed feelings about Axe body spray. Some share stories of teenage crushes who wore it, making the scent memorable in a positive way. Others recall being in crowded classrooms where the smell was overwhelming. One viral Reddit thread featured women rating men’s cologne, and Axe was described as both “a teenage classic” and “the scent of high school hallways.” These real accounts reveal that while Axe holds nostalgic charm, it may not always be the fragrance of choice in adulthood.

The Psychology of Scent and Attraction

Fragrance plays a powerful role in attraction. Studies show that women often prefer scents that feel natural, balanced, and not overpowering. The question “do women like Axe body spray?” depends not only on the scent itself but also on how it’s worn. A light application can be pleasant, but heavy use may lead to negative impressions. Women tend to appreciate individuality in fragrance choices, meaning that a man’s confidence and how he carries himself can influence how the scent is received. This makes fragrance a deeply personal yet social experience.

Axe in Pop Culture and Social Media

Axe has been referenced countless times in TV shows, movies, and online memes, usually as a symbol of teenage masculinity. Social media is filled with jokes about boys using half a can before school, which adds humor but also reflects real experiences. At the same time, modern trends show a growing preference for more sophisticated and subtle fragrances. While Axe remains iconic, its place in pop culture has shifted from a symbol of instant attraction to one of nostalgia and humor. This shift also influences how women perceive the scent today.

Choosing the Right Fragrance for Success

Whether women like Axe body spray often comes down to how and when it’s used. For casual, youthful settings, it can still be a fun and acceptable choice. However, in professional or romantic contexts, many women prefer subtler, more refined scents. Men looking to make a lasting impression may benefit from exploring other fragrance options that highlight personality and maturity. For those uncertain about which fragrance best suits them, exploring different notes—such as woody, citrus, or musky blends—can be an eye-opening experience.
